site stats

Opencl max work group size

Web13 de mar. de 2016 · Hi, I am using OPENCL for last two months and pretty much understood the basics of it. I am working on NVIDIA QUADRO 410 card. ... Max work items[2]: 1024 Max work group size: 1024 Preferred vector width char: 16 Preferred vector width short: 8 Preferred vector width int: 4 Web13 de abr. de 2024 · size は、device_type で指定されるタイプのデバイスに使用される推奨 work-group サイズを示します。 リダクションがキューに投入されるデバイスの info::device::max_work_group_size が、この環境変数で設定される値よりも小さい場合、そのデバイスの info::device::max_work_group_size 値が代わりに使用されます。

OpenCL optimal work group size - AMD Community

WebA bare minimum SLM allocation size is 4k per workgroup, so even if your kernel requires less bytes per work-group, the actual allocation still will be 4k. To accommodate many … Web13 de abr. de 2010 · We will not go into those details in this writeup; for our runs on the CPU device, we will use the largest possible workgroup size (32x32). Now on a CPU device I get: Max compute units: 2. Max work items dimensions: 3. Max work items [0]: 1024. Max work items [1]: 1024. Max work items [2]: 1024. Max work group size: 1024. raja full album https://servidsoluciones.com

インテル® oneAPI ツールキット 2024 における DPC++ ラン ...

Web12 de out. de 2011 · CL_DEVICE_MAX_WORK_GROUP_SIZE: 1024. CL_KERNEL_WORK_GROUP_SIZE: 256. So if I understand everything correctly, then … Web19 de set. de 2024 · command_queue is a valid host command-queue. The kernel will be queued for execution on the device associated with command_queue. kernel is a valid kernel object. The OpenCL context associated with kernel and command-queue must be the same.. work_dim is the number of dimensions used to specify the global work-items and … WebYou can specify the size of the work-group that OpenCL uses when you enqueue a kernel to execute on a device. To do this, you must know the maximum work-group size permitted by the OpenCL device your work-items execute on. To find the maximum work-group size for a specific kernel, use the clGetKernelWorkGroupInfo () function and request the CL ... raja gopal krotthapalli

インテル® oneAPI ツールキット 2024 における DPC++ ラン ...

Category:Altera + OpenCL: программируем под FPGA без ...

Tags:Opencl max work group size

Opencl max work group size

Determine max global work group size based on device memory …

Web15 de out. de 2024 · If " Max work group size" is reported as 256 then that is the max. limit for work-group size (multiplying all the dimensions i.e. X *Y *Z).Though I'm little bit … Web4 de jan. de 2010 · Originally posted by: genaganna Bubu, This is no static tool available now to find optimal work group size. Presently you can do as follows. 1. Get …

Opencl max work group size

Did you know?

Web15 de jun. de 2016 · I am a new OpenCL programmer, and I am confused about how to set the workgroup size. Which is the correct way to set the workgroup size: setting … Web7 de mai. de 2012 · The output from clinfo: Number of platforms: 1 Platform Profile: FULL_PROFILE Platform Version: OpenCL 1.2 AMD-APP (923.1) Platform Name: AMD …

Web3 de jun. de 2010 · OpenCL. phoebe0105 June 3, 2010, 1:01pm 1. In my source code, I just use two work-items. global work size is 50 and local work size is also 50. But I’m ... Web7 de mai. de 2012 · The output from clinfo: Number of platforms: 1 Platform Profile: FULL_PROFILE Platform Version: OpenCL 1.2 AMD-APP (923.1) Platform Name: AMD Accelerated Parallel Processing Platform Vendor: Advanced Micro Devices, Inc. Platform Extensions: cl_khr_icd cl_amd_event_callback cl_amd_offline_devices …

WebThe OpenCL implementation uses the resource requirements of the kernel (register usage etc.) to determine what this work-group size should be. As a result and unlike CL_DEVICE_MAX_WORK_GROUP_SIZE this value may vary from one kernel to another as well as one device to another. Web31 de out. de 2013 · 10-31-2013 03:15 PM. The specified 256 work-items in question refers to the total number of work-items in a work-group regardless of whether it is 1-, 2- or 3-dimensions and not the number of work-items in a particular direction. For instance, valid work-group sizes in the format {x, y, z} can be {256, 1, 1} or {16, 16, 1} or {8, 8, 4}.

Web23 de out. de 2024 · Subgroup. Subgroups are an implementation-dependent grouping of work items within a work group. The size and number of subgroups is implementation-defined and not exposed in the core OpenCL 2.0 feature set. Subgroups execute concurrently within a work group, but are not guaranteed to make independent forward …

WebDo not think that a single work group is the same thing as a single compute shader invocation; there's a reason why it is called a "group". Within a single work group, there may be many compute shader invocations. How many is defined by the compute shader itself, not by the call that executes it. This is known as the local size of the work group. raja guellouzWeb22 de nov. de 2014 · A workgroup size can be limited because the local memory is limited. And this limit can be reached if you have a kernel that uses lots of private memory (“lots” … cybevasion cantalWebThe work-group size in each dimension must divide evenly into the requested NDRange size in each dimension. The work-group size must not exceed the device constraints … raja hai mahan lyricsWeb8 de nov. de 2015 · Всем привет! Altera SDK for OpenCL — это набор библиотек и приложений, который позволяет компилировать код, написанный на OpenCL, в прошивку для ПЛИС фирмы Altera.Это даёт возможность программисту использовать FPGA как ускоритель ... raja h assafWeb28 de abr. de 2011 · My GPU contains 18 compute units and each work-group supports a maximum of 256 work-items. When I execute my kernel with 16 * 256 items, OpenCL creates 16 work-groups and I get the right answer. But when I execute with 32 * 256 items, OpenCL creates 32 work-groups and I get the wrong answer. Does the maximum # of … raja gorden makassarhttp://opencl.gpuinfo.org/listreports.php?deviceinfo=CL_DEVICE_MAX_WORK_GROUP_SIZE&value=8192 raja grill rushdenWeb对于任何设备,ALU 获取的最佳比率为 1:1。. 这在实践中很少实现,因此您希望保持 ALU/SIMD 组饱和。. 这意味着 ALU:fetch 应尽可能大于 1。. 小于 1 意味着您应该尝试更大的工作组大小以更好地隐藏内存延迟。. 关于opencl - 确定最佳工作组大小和工作组数量的算法 … cyberzone stores in megamall